Top Attractions Around Poole Old Town
What attractions are nearby?
Within this charming area, you can enjoy a variety of activities such as exploring historic sites, strolling along scenic waterfronts, and discovering local shops and dining options, all conveniently close to your rental by owner in Poole Old Town.

Family Activities
- Poole Harbour Tours: Embark on a family-friendly boat tour to explore the stunning Poole Harbour, offering scenic views and close encounters with local wildlife.
- Old Town Museum: Discover the rich maritime history of the area at the Old Town Museum, engaging children with interactive exhibits and local stories.
- Poole Quay: Enjoy a leisurely stroll along the lively quay, where you can watch boats come and go and find cafes perfect for family outings.
- Baiter Park: Relax and play in this expansive park featuring playgrounds, open grass areas, and panoramic views of the water, ideal for family picnics and outdoor fun.
Adult Activities
- Visit Poole Museum and Art Gallery: Explore local history and contemporary art within a historic building in the heart of the Old Town, offering an engaging experience for adults seeking cultural enrichment.
- Stroll along Poole Quay: Enjoy picturesque views of the harbor while dining at waterfront cafes or browsing boutique shops, perfect for a relaxing day by the water.
- Take a boat tour from Poole Harbour: Discover scenic coastal landscapes and wildlife on a guided boat trip that showcases the region’s maritime heritage and natural beauty.
- Experience authentic local cuisine: Dine at highly-rated restaurants and pubs nestled within the narrow streets, where you can savor fresh seafood and regional specialties with a charming backdrop.

Transportation Options
- Poole Town Centre Bus Service: The extensive local bus network provides convenient transportation throughout the area, making it easy to explore Poole Old Town and its surroundings.
- Poole Railway Station: Located just a short distance from the heart of the region, the train station offers reliable rail connections to major cities and nearby destinations.
- Taxi and Ride-Sharing Services: Several licensed taxi companies and ride-sharing options are available for quick, direct travel within Poole Old Town and to neighboring areas.
- Walking and Biking: The compact and scenic streets make walking and biking ideal ways to discover the charm of this destination at your own pace.
